D

Douglas Elbinger
Review of Ami ads bureau

1 year ago

Ami ads bureau has been instrumental in the succes...

Ami ads bureau has been instrumental in the success of my business. Their advertising strategies have brought a significant increase in customer engagement. I highly recommend their services.

Comments:

No comments